I am not after State BJP Presidentship, clarifies Sadananda Gowda

dvs13mar18 1Mangalore, Mar 18, 2013: Former chief minister DV Sadananda Gowda has made it clear that he was not after the post of State BJP Presidentship.


Speaking to media men in Mangalore on March 17, Sunday, Gowda  also said that he had never lobbied for the post. “ The BJP National President Rajnath Singh is presently on a Varnasi tour and he will decide on the appointment once he returns to the national capital,” Sadananda Gowda said and also hoped that the most suitable candidate will be chosen for the top post.


When   media men drew his attention towards the statement of Housing Minister V Somanna that  the party leadership would be pressurized to bring back Yeddyurappa to the BJP fold,  Sadananda Gowda said he was unaware of the same. “The matter has also not come up at the BJP core committee meeting held on March 16.  Somanna is close to Yeddyurappa. Therefore, it is best for him to comment on his statement,”  Gowda said.


Sadananda Gowda on this occasion informed that the BJP will be holding rallies and conventions throughout the state from March 23 to 30 in order to place before the public the achievements of the State BJP government and the anti-people policies of the UPA government at the Centre.
